Our highschooler
I know its probably not very exciting for some people, but today was a big day for us all as Kyla started school at Hendra Secondary School.
She was very nervous as she prepared herself for school, starting with the uniform for the day and the rather large bag full of school books. On the way to school, she shed a few tears and was very twitchy as I left her at reception for her to collect her timetable etc.
I felt very sorry for her as its such a big thing for her to do. This is the first time that she hasnt had any of her siblings around and she is still only 12 and probably the youngest in her class. I totally get how she feels since I also started highschool at 12.
Anyway, when I picked her up after school she seemed alot better and had enjoyed her first day at school 'phew'. These are some afterschool photos that I took of her
